Saint Clair Shores, Michigan, United States

Overview

Saint Clair Shores is a lakefront suburb northeast of Detroit, known for its beautiful marinas, relaxed atmosphere, and lively Nautical Mile. The city offers a mix of waterfront recreation, family-friendly neighborhoods, and local eateries. It's a popular spot for boating, casual dining, and enjoying views of Lake St. Clair.

Best Time to Visit

May-September for warm weather, lake activities, and summer festivals.

Local Tips

Explore the Nautical Mile for the best lakeside restaurants and consider renting bikes to ride along the shoreline parks. Public transport is limited, so having a car is helpful.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ping 15-20% is standard at restaurants and bars. Dress is casual; summer wear is common in lakeside areas. Be courteous and respectful in residential neighborhoods.

Safety Warnings

Saint Clair Shores is generally safe, but exercise caution in poorly lit areas after dark and keep personal belongings secure. Traffic can be busy during festivals along the Nautical Mile.

Hidden Gems

Check out Blossom Heath Park for tranquil lake views, the local farmers market in summer, and the historical St. Clair Shores Public Library.
